Broken FFC Cable
 
I've owned my HTC Mogul for around 8 months now and it's been a great phone to me. A little while ago the directional pad at the bottom sopped working which made me a little nervous. I figured it was nothing, but then the landscape mode stopped working. It would just freeze when I changed. And soon the entire screen just stopped showing things other than the very rare occasion. Long story short, I read a lot about repair costs and what not (it's out of warranty) and decided to pop it open. I quickly discovered a slice in the main connecter cable (the one between the screen portion and the keyboard portion). That pretty much summed it up. I've been looking for a replacement part all over the internet but not to much success. I was hoping that you guys would have some input.

demonlordoftheround 03-30-2009 08:52 AM

Re: Broken FFC Cable
 
You might try stopping by a repair center, they might have one and depending on who's there, might be willing to part with it. Otherwise look for one with a broken screen on craigslist that you can scavenge for parts.
